I was building my own contract here: https://www.blockcypher.com/dev/ethereum/#create-contract-endpoint
ENGINE.PHP
<?php function blockcypher($method,$page,$data = ""){ $curl = curl_init(); curl_setopt($curl, CURLOPT_URL, "https://api.blockcypher.com/v1/".$page); curl_setopt($curl, CURLOPT_RETURNTRANSFER, 1); if($data != ''){ curl_setopt($curl, CURLOPT_POSTFIELDS, $data); } curl_setopt($curl, CURLOPT_CUSTOMREQUEST, $method); curl_setopt($curl, CURLOPT_SSL_VERIFYHOST, false); curl_setopt($curl, CURLOPT_SSL_VERIFYPEER, false); $headers = array(); $headers[] = 'Content-Type: application/x-www-form-urlencoded'; curl_setopt($curl, CURLOPT_HTTPHEADER, $headers); $result = curl_exec($curl); if (curl_errno($curl)) { echo 'Error:' . curl_error($curl); } curl_close ($curl); return $result; } ?>
PROCESS.PHP
<?php session_start(); error_reporting(1); include 'ENGINE.PHP'; $token = '?token=YOURFREETOKEN'; $server = "eth/main"; $data = "{\"solidity\":\"contract mortal { address owner; function mortal() { owner = msg.sender; } function kill() { if (msg.sender == owner) suicide(owner); } } contract greeter is mortal { string greeting; function greeter(string _greeting) public { greeting = _greeting; } function greet() constant returns (string) { return greeting; } }\",\"params\":[\"Hello BlockCypher Test\"]}"; $contract_details = blockcypher("POST","$server/contracts$token",$data); echo "<br><br>USDT Generate Contract: "; var_dump($contract_details);
Output from PROCESS.PHP
USDT Generate Contract: string(101) "{"error": "Error compiling Solidity source code: fork/exec /usr/bin/solc: no such file or directory"}"
I'm getting this error and could not know what is the problem because have such less knowledge in this kind of thing.
